 he 29th Tjejmilen will be staged on Saturday 1 September 2012. This is the biggest sporting event in Sweden for women with 30,000 female runners and joggers of all ages.
Everyone loves the scenic course through the royal park ”Djurgården” in central Stockholm. The distance is 10,000 metres 

In this race every runner participates on her own terms and runs at her own pace, no matter how old or fit she is. In the Tjemilen all finishers are winners!

Live music along the course

Along the course rock bands, brass bands, samba orchestras and DJs will inspire you with music.

Medal and picnic

All finishers receive an exclusive commemorative medal. After the race all runners are served Swedish Cheesecake, fruit, mineral water and coffee.

Water and sports drink

Along the course there are four refreshment stations where water and sports drink are available.

Ideal running conditions

The average temperature in Stockholm the first week of September is 17° C, equal to 58 degrees Fahrenheit. The humidity is around 50 per cent.

 

A race and a fun run

The Tjejmilen is a race and a fun run. You can choose if you want to participate in the Competition Class or in the Fun Run.
Competition Class: Your running time is recorded in the results list. Your intermediate time at 5 kilometres is also recorded. In 2011, 58 per cent of the runners chose the Competition Class.
Fun Run. Here you jog at your own pace and check your own time on the digital clocks at the finish line.
In 2011, 42 per cent of the runners chose the Fun Run.
The start is divided into 15 groups which start at 5 or 10 minutes intervals.

Competition class: qualifying limits for start groups 1–3

If you enter the Competition class and want to start in one of the first three groups, you must have achieved one of these qualifying times during 2011 or 2012:

Group 1
• Sub 52 minutes in a 10 kilometre race.
• Sub 24 minutes in a 5 kilometre race.
• Sub 1 hour 55 minutes in a half marathon race.
• Sub 4 hours 00 minutes in a marathon race.

Group 2
• Sub 56 minutes in a 10 kilometre race.
• Sub 26 minutes in a 5 kilometre race.
• Sub 2 hours and 00 minutes in a half marathon race.

Group 3
• Sub 58 minutes in a 10 kilometre race.
• Sub 27 minutes in a 5 kilometre race.
• Sub 2 hours and 05 minutes in a half marathon race.

When you enter, please specify where and when you achieved the qualifying limit. Name of race, date and your result.

Choose one of groups 4 – 15

The start is divided into 15 groups that start at 5 or 10 minutes intervals. The first three groups are reserved for the fastest in the Competition Class.
Start groups 4 – 15 are for the remaining runners in the Competition Class and for all participants in the Fun Run.
You choose a group according to your running ability when you enter.
There will be a maximum of 2,000 runners in each group.
The first group starts at 13:00. Group 15 starts at 14:40.

    Maximum 32,000 runners

    The interest in Tjejmilen has increased during the last couple of years. from 21,964 registered runners in 2007 to a record number of 30,576 runners for the 2011 Tjejmilen.
    In 2012 a maximum of 32,000 runners will be accepted.
